src/feedParserPromised.test.js
const { internet } = require('faker');
const nock = require('nock');
const xmlbuilder = require('xmlbuilder');
const { parse } = require('./feedParserPromised');
describe('FeedParserPromised', () => {
let aHost, uri;
const feedPath = '/feed';
const rssFeedXML = xmlbuilder
.create({
rss: {
channel: [
{
item: {
title: 'first item'
}
},
{
item: {
title: 'second item'
}
}
]
}
})
.end({ pretty: true });
beforeEach(() => {
aHost = internet.url();
uri = aHost.concat(feedPath);
});
it('parses a feed', async () => {
nock(aHost)
.get(feedPath)
.reply(200, rssFeedXML);
const [firstFeed, secondFeed] = await parse(uri);
expect(firstFeed['rss:title']).toEqual({ '@': {}, '#': 'first item' });
expect(secondFeed['rss:title']).toEqual({ '@': {}, '#': 'second item' });
});
it('accepts request options', async () => {
nock(aHost)
.get(feedPath)
.reply(200, rssFeedXML);
const [firstFeed, secondFeed] = await parse({ uri, gzip: true });
expect(firstFeed['rss:title']).toEqual({ '@': {}, '#': 'first item' });
expect(secondFeed['rss:title']).toEqual({ '@': {}, '#': 'second item' });
});
it('accepts feedparser options', async () => {
nock(aHost)
.get(feedPath)
.reply(200, rssFeedXML);
const [firstFeed, secondFeed] = await parse(uri, { normalize: false });
expect(firstFeed['rss:title']).toEqual({ '@': {}, '#': 'first item' });
expect(secondFeed['rss:title']).toEqual({ '@': {}, '#': 'second item' });
});
it('handles malformed feed', done => {
const badFeed = {};
nock(aHost)
.get(feedPath)
.reply(200, badFeed);
parse(uri).catch(error => {
expect(error.message).toMatch(/Not a feed/);
done();
});
});
it('handles invalid URI', done => {
parse('invalid uri').catch(error => {
expect(error.message).toMatch(/Invalid URI "invalid%20uri"/);
done();
});
});
});
